From what I know about iPhones and ipads, if you plan on holding it long term you want the latest version as Apple will support software updates longer. If you are planning on letting your child use it, don't get the biggest sized one as they might have trouble holding it. And always get a decent protective case.

I am just looking at the latest Office Works brochure. The Ipad 8 is $ 496, the Ipad mini is $ 579 and the Air is $ 896. However the mini and the air are both 64GB memory ( so more storage) and the Ipad 8 is only 32GB, hence why they are more expensive.

My DH in IT says the more storage the better. Check the price of the Ipad 8 with 64GB.
